Cons of eating organic foods
Illustrate the cons of eating organic foods?
Expert
It is extra expensive and we have less variety to choose. Stores as Wegamans have a variety of organic food. As organic produce doesn’t have stabilizers and chemicals, it spoils quickly. It also may appear "uglier" (dirty, not waxy or shiny, asymmetrical).
